Pre-Requisites for Connecting Your Magnavox Smart TV to WiFi

Before you start the connection process, make sure you have the following:

  • A Magnavox smart TV with built-in WiFi capabilities
  • A wireless router or modem with an active internet connection
  • The WiFi network name (SSID) and password
  • A stable power supply to your TV and router

Locating the WiFi Settings on Your Magnavox Smart TV

To connect your Magnavox smart TV to WiFi, you need to access the WiFi settings menu. The location of this menu may vary depending on the model of your TV. Here’s how to find it:

  • Press the “Menu” button on your remote control
  • Navigate to the “Settings” or “System Settings” option
  • Scroll down to the “Network” or “Wireless” section
  • Select “WiFi Settings” or “Wireless Settings”

Connecting Your Magnavox Smart TV to WiFi

Now that you’ve located the WiFi settings menu, it’s time to connect your TV to your wireless network. Follow these steps:

  • Select the “WiFi Settings” or “Wireless Settings” option
  • Choose your WiFi network from the list of available networks
  • Enter your WiFi network password using the on-screen keyboard
  • Select “Connect” or “Join Network”

Troubleshooting Common WiFi Connection Issues

If you’re having trouble connecting your Magnavox smart TV to WiFi, here are some common issues and their solutions:

  • Incorrect WiFi Network Password: Double-check your WiFi network password and try again.
  • Weak WiFi Signal: Move your router closer to your TV or use a WiFi range extender to boost the signal.
  • Network Congestion: Restart your router and try connecting again.

Using a WiFi Analyzer App to Optimize Your WiFi Signal

A WiFi analyzer app can help you optimize your WiFi signal by identifying channel overlap and interference. Here’s how to use a WiFi analyzer app:

  • Download and install a WiFi analyzer app on your smartphone or tablet
  • Launch the app and scan for nearby WiFi networks
  • Identify the channel with the least overlap and interference
  • Change your router’s channel to the recommended one

How do I connect my Magnavox Smart TV to a hidden wireless network?

Connecting your Magnavox Smart TV to a hidden wireless network is a bit more complicated than connecting to a visible network. To do this, you will need to know your network’s name and password. You will also need to know the type of security your network is using, such as WEP, WPA, or WPA2.

To connect to a hidden network, go to your Magnavox Smart TV’s WiFi settings menu and select the option to connect to a hidden network. You will then be prompted to enter your network’s name and password. Make sure to enter the correct information, as incorrect entries can prevent you from connecting to the network. If you are having trouble connecting, try restarting your router and TV, or contacting your internet service provider for further assistance.

Can I connect my Magnavox Smart TV to a wireless network using a WiFi adapter?

Yes, you can connect your Magnavox Smart TV to a wireless network using a WiFi adapter. A WiFi adapter is a device that plugs into your TV’s USB port and allows it to connect to a wireless network. This can be useful if your TV does not have built-in WiFi capabilities.

To connect your TV to a wireless network using a WiFi adapter, simply plug the adapter into your TV’s USB port and follow the on-screen instructions to connect to your network. You will need to know your network’s name and password to complete the connection process. Make sure to purchase a WiFi adapter that is compatible with your TV’s make and model.
